Moreover, Teams offers advanced security options, such as cloud-storage service and file permissions (handy if you want a third party to access your document in Teams). Microsoft Teams is in the lead from the start - it gives you 5 GB per user in its free plan and the storage expands to 1 TB per user with Microsoft 365 Business Basic plan.

What some hybrid and remote companies might find attractive is Microsoft Teams’ language availability - it covers about 80 world languages, including Turkish, Serbian, Polish, and Hungarian. You can easily integrate it with other Microsoft products and services, such as Microsoft email, calendar, or cloud. Microsoft Teams can help simplify group work and group communication.
